The X-rays that go through the object are captured driving the item by a detector (either photographic movie or perhaps a electronic detector). The generation of flat two-dimensional illustrations or photos by this technique is referred to as projectional radiography. In computed tomography (CT scanning), an X-ray resource and its connected detectors rotate all-around the subject, which alone moves with the conical X-ray beam manufactured. Any provided issue inside the topic is crossed from quite a few directions by a number of beams at different instances. Facts regarding the attenuation of those beams is collated and subjected to computation to generate two-dimensional photographs on a few planes (axial, coronal, and sagittal) which can be even more processed to produce a three-dimensional picture.

A classical X-ray tube is depicted in Fig. 7.7. An X-ray tube is basically an evacuated tube manufactured from glass having a cathode in addition to a good metal anode in it. Thermionic emission occurs with the heated filament in the cathode. Warmth induced electrons e− are made as the thermal Power applied to the filament product is much larger than its binding Strength.

Allow us to target the enter phosphor layer in more detail. A person vital assets that influences the effeciency of your enter phosphor layer is its thickness. The thicker the phosphor layer, the upper is its absorption, Consequently, extra X-ray photons are absorbed and transformed to light.

fluroscopy allows for actual time X-ray sequences that happen to be normally inevitable in minimally invasive interventions. read more Even further, dir issue of quick improvement is the attention that X-rays can be dangerous. High energies emitted to the body for the duration of an X-ray acquisition can lead to ionization. Meaning the radiation alterations the atomic construction in the tissue which may probably bring about an increased danger for the event of most cancers. Below, deoxyribonucleic acid (DNA) gets destroyed through the radiation. Normally, the DNA will probably be repaired via the mobile itself.
